Central Coast Tech Networking Mixer returns to Atascadero Thursday

Free event is open to the public
– The Central Coast Tech Networking Mixer will bring together local business community members, entrepreneurs, remote workers, and those interested in technology on Thursday, March 26, at 5:30 p.m. at BridgeWorks in downtown Atascadero.
The free event is open to the public and offers attendees the opportunity to connect in person, exchange ideas, and learn about projects others are building across the Central Coast.
“This is a chance to get out of the heat, meet other technologists and professionals, and be inspired by what people around you are working on,” said Albert Qian, founder of Albert’s List. “Some of the most valuable connections start with a simple conversation.”
The mixer series launched in 2024 and has drawn hundreds of attendees from across the region. Past conversations have ranged from artificial intelligence and startup projects to career growth and local business initiatives.
Pizza from Fatte’s will be served.
